#inner {
	border-top: none!important;
}

/* settings - start */
body {
    font-size: 11px;
	    background: #a9d0f5  url("")  repeat-x;
}
a {
    color: #000000;
}

a:hover {
    color: #000000;
}
#menu {
		background: #000000 url("") repeat-x;
}
.nav li li {
    background: #000000 none repeat;
}
.nav li li a:hover {
    background-color: #000000;
}
.nav a {
    color: #ffffff;
}
.nav li li a {
    color: #ffffff;
}

#nav li a {
	    background: #3d3d3d url("") repeat-x;
    color: #ffffff;
}

#nav li a:hover {
    background-color: #383838;
    color: #ffffff;
}

#left-slave {
    background-color: ;
}

#right-slave {
    background-color: ;
}
#country-list a{
    color: #000000;
}
#country-list a:hover{
    color: #000000;
}
#footer {
	    background: #3dbdf0 url("") repeat-x;
    color: #ffffff;
}
#footer a {
    color: #ffffff;
}

.altrow,
.sm-result:nth-child(2n+1){
    background-color: #eee;
}
    background-color: #eee;
}

table.scroll tbody tr.alt{
    background-color: #eee;
}

.top-offer-square{
    background: #eee;
}

#master{
        width:749px;border-right:none;
            }

#show-map{
    color : #000000;
}

/* settings - own */

/*.trip-count{background: #d2e1fb;}
#wrap {width:902px;}
#inner {border:0px;}
#head {border:0px;}
#menu {height:48px;}
.nav a {line-height:50px;}
.top-offer-huge-line .inner {border:0px;}
.sm-result .inner {border:0px;}
.top-offer-square {border:0px;}
#search-mask {padding-top:20px;}
#left-slave {margin-top:13px;}
.sidebox-content {margin-bottom:10px;}
#footer {height:40px;line-height:45px;}
#sidebg {background: url(/11281/files/editor/image/39.jpg) repeat-y center;}
#footer2 {background: url(/11281/files/editor/image/39_35.jpg) repeat-x; height: 15px; width: 912px; margin: 0 auto;}
.nav a {
line-height:43px;
}
#search-mask .submit input {border: none;
background: url(/11281/img/hleda.png);
height: 30px; width: 130px;padding: 3px 0 0 7px;
color: white; font-weight: bold;
}
.background-all{
background: transparent url("/11281/img/background-all.gif") repeat-y top center;
}
.background-footer{
background: transparent url("/11281/img/background-footer.jpg") no-repeat bottom center;
}
.nav a {
padding-left:18px;
padding-right:18px;
}*/

/* -------- */
/* REDESIGN */
/* -------- */

/* -- Obecne -- */

#main,#wrap,#head{
	width:1003px;
}
#inner,#head,#head img,#master,#left-slave,#right-slave{
	background-color:transparent;
}
#inner,#head,#cont,#master,#footer{
	border:none;
}
#left-slave,
#right-slave{
	width:257px !important;
}
#left-slave{
	margin-right:10px;
}
#right-slave{
	margin-left:10px;
}
#master{
	width:auto;
}
.purple{
	color:black;
}
.contentpages-home .master-title.cd-title{
	display:none;
}
.contentpages-home .cd-content.page-content{
	background-color:transparent;
}
/* -- Header -- */
#head{
	/*background:url('/11281/uploads/fs_images/contentdesignimagesets/4/header-bg_336_o.png') top center no-repeat;*/
}
#head img{
	width:auto;
}
#headerBox{
	text-align:center;
	color:black;
	font-size:21px;
}
#headerBox h2{
	font-size:31px;
	margin:25px 0;
}
#headerBox .velke{
	font-size:32px;
	letter-spacing:1px;
}
#headerBox .male{
	font-size:15px;
}
#headerBox .prokladane{
	letter-spacing:2px;
}
#body{
	color:black;
}

/* -- Menu -- */
#menu{
	height:60px;
	border-bottom:1px solid #fff;
	margin-bottom:25px;
	text-align:center;
	background-color:#36dbe7;
	border-radius: 8px;
}
#menu ul > li div > a{
	/*background:url('/11281/uploads/fs_images/contentdesignimagesets/4/menu-item-bg_337_o.png') no-repeat right top;*/
	height:60px;
	line-height:60px;
	display:block;
	font-size:20px;
	font-weight:normal;
	padding:0 21px;
	color:black;
	border-radius: 8px;
}
#menu ul > li div > a:hover{
	transition-duration: 0.4s;
	color:white;
	background-color: #44ebf7;
}
.nav li:hover ul, ul.nav li.sfHover ul{
	z-index:5;
	top:60px;
}
.nav li:hover ul li a, ul.nav li.sfHover ul li a{
	font-weight:normal;
}


/* -- Sidebox -- */
.sidebox{
	width:244px !important;
	margin-bottom:25px;
	border:1px solid #CEF1F8;
	background-color: #CEF1F8;
	border-radius: 8px;
	color:white;
}
.sidebox table{
	width:244px !important;
	border-radius: 8px;
}
.sidebox .cd-title{
	margin-bottom:5px;
	border-radius: 8px;
}
.sidebox .cd-title .text{
	line-height:53px;
	padding: 0 10px 0 10px;
	font-weight:normal;
	border-radius: 8px;
}
.exchangerates-sidebox .cd-content .right{
	padding:5px;
	border-radius: 8px;
}  
.default-sidebox-design.newsletters-view .cd-title{
	background: -moz-linear-gradient(top,  #36dbe7 0%, #36dbe7 100%);
	background: -webkit-gradient(linear, left top, left bottom, color-stop(0%,#490b51), color-stop(100%,#670e72));
	background: -webkit-linear-gradient(top,  #490b51 0%,#670e72 100%);
	background: -o-linear-gradient(top,  #490b51 0%,#670e72 100%);
	background: -ms-linear-gradient(top,  #490b51 0%,#670e72 100%);
	background: linear-gradient(to bottom,  #490b51 0%,#670e72 100%);
	color:black;
	border-radius: 8px;
}
.default-sidebox-design.newsletters-view .cd-title .text{
	background-color:#36dbe7;
	width:224px;
	color:black;
	text.align:center;
	font-size:22px;
	border-radius: 8px;
}
.sidebox input[type=text]{
	width:220px;
	border:1px solid #36dbe7;
	padding:4px;
	border-radius: 8px;
}
.sidebox input[type=submit]{
	border:none;
	background:#36dbe7 url('/11281/uploads/fs_images/contentdesignimagesets/4/sidebox-submit_342_o.png') no-repeat center right;
	border:1px solid #36dbe7;
	padding:4px;
	border-radius: 8px;
}


/* -- Master -- */
.contentmenu-img-big{
	margin-bottom:20px;
	border-radius: 8px;
}
.contentmenu-img{
	width:176px;
	background: #490b51;
	background: -moz-linear-gradient(top,  #490b51 0%, #670e72 100%);
	background: -webkit-gradient(linear, left top, left bottom, color-stop(0%,#490b51), color-stop(100%,#670e72));
	background: -webkit-linear-gradient(top,  #490b51 0%,#670e72 100%);
	background: -o-linear-gradient(top,  #490b51 0%,#670e72 100%);
	background: -ms-linear-gradient(top,  #490b51 0%,#670e72 100%);
	background: linear-gradient(to bottom,  #490b51 0%,#670e72 100%);
	fil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#490b51', endColorstr='#670e72',GradientType=0 );
	text-align:center;
	margin-right:10px;
	border-radius: 8px;
}
.contentmenu-img.last{
	margin-right:0;
	border-radius: 8px;
}
.contentmenu-img a{
	display:block;
	width:176px;
	font-size:18px;
	color:black;
	padding:12px 0;
	text-decoration:none;
	background: url('/11281/uploads/fs_images/contentdesignimagesets/4/content-menu-bg_333_o.png') no-repeat bottom center;
}
.contentmenu-img a:hover{
	text-decoration:underline;
}

/* -- Searchmask -- */
.searchmasks-view .cd-title{
	border-right:1px solid #abdae5;
	border-top:-10px solid #abdae5;
	border-left:1px solid #abdae5;
	padding-left:28px;
	line-height:54px;
	border-radius: 8px;
}
.search-mask{
	position:relative;
	margin-bottom:30px;
	border-right:1px solid #abdae5;
	border-bottom:1px solid #abdae5;
	border-left:1px solid #abdae5;
	width:734px;
	border-radius: 8px;
}
.search-mask form{
	padding: 28px;
}
.search-mask .input{
	width:209px;
	margin-right:22px;
	border-radius: 8px;
}
.search-mask input[type=text],
.search-mask select{
	width:209px;
	border:1px solid #aed5de;
	padding:4px;
	margin:5px 0 0 0;
	box-sizing:border-box;
	-moz-box-sizing:border-box; /* Firefox */
	-webkit-box-sizing:border-box; /* Safari */
	border-radius: 8px;
}
.sm-pos-3,
.sm-pos-6,
.sm-pos-9,
.sm-pos-12,
.sm-pos-15{
	margin-right:0 !important;
	border-radius: 8px;
}
.search-mask .submit{
		height:45px;
	width:220px;
	position:absolute;
	bottom:-12px;
	right:19px;
	border-radius: 8px;
} 
.search-mask input[type=submit]{
	background-color:#36dbe7;
	width:208px;
	height:45px;
	border:none;
	color:black;
	font-size:23px;
	position:absolute;
	bottom:32px;
	right:10px;
	transition-duration: 0.4s;
	border-radius: 8px;
	cursor: pointer;
}
.search-mask:hover input[type=submit]{
	color:white;
	background-color: #44ebf7;
}

/* -- Top offer - sloupcova -- */
.default-design .cd-content.top-offers{
	background-color:transparent;
	border-radius: 8px;
}
.sloupcovaInner{
	border:1px solid #cee3f7;
	width:360px;
	background-color:#ccf0f7;
	margin-bottom:15px;
	border-radius: 8px;
	color: black;
}
.sloupcovaInner a{
	text-decoration:none;
	color: black;
}

.sloupcovaCountry{
	width:345px;
	background-color:#bbe5ee;
	line-height:30px;
	min-height:30px;
	padding-left:15px;
	border-radius: 8px;
}
.sloupcovaCountry a{
	text-transform:uppercase;
	font-size:11px;
	color:black;
}
.sloupcovaContent{
	padding:5px 10px 10px 10px;
	border-radius: 8px;
}  
.sloupcovaThumb{
	border:1px solid #cee3f7;
	margin-right:15px; 
	border-radius: 8px;
}
.sloupcovaThumb img{
	border:2px solid #fff;
	width:134px;
	height: 94px;
}
.sloupcovaInfo {
	width:185px;
	font-size:14px;
	color: black;
}
.sloupcovaInfo h2{
	margin:0 0 5px 0;
	font-size:18px;
	color:black;
}
.sloupcovaDiscount{
	color:black;
}
.sloupcovaPrice a{
	font-size:18px;
	color:black;
}


/* -- Footer -- */
#footer{
	padding: 20px 0;
	text-align:center;
	height:auto;
	margin-bottom:20px;

}


.side-weather .cd-content{
  display:table;
  width: 91%;
}
.side-weather .cd-content ul{
  display:table-row;
}
.side-weather .cd-content ul li{
  display:table-cell;
  vertical-align:middle;
  padding:1px;
  font-size:12px;
}
.side-weather .cd-content ul li img{
  position:static;
}
.side-weather .cd-content br{
  display:none;
}
.side-weather ul li:last-child,
.exchangerates-sidebox tr td:last-child{
  text-align:right;
  font-weight:bold;
}

input[type=submit]{
	cursor:pointer;
}

.default-design .cd-content,
.search-mask label,
.default-sidebox-design .cd-content {
	color: #000 !important;
}

.searchmasks-view-1 .cd-title {
	margin-bottom: 10px;
}

#search-mask {
	font-size: 16px;	
}

.searchmask-global .selectBox, 
.searchmask-global input[type='text'], 
.searchmask-global .dest-selector-opener {
	height: 28px;
	margin-top: 3px;
	box-sizing: border-box;
}

.adds-top-title {
	padding: 1rem;
}

.adds-top-id {
    box-sizing: border-box;
    padding: 1rem;
}
/* settings - stop */


/* content design - on v2 */
.default-floatbox-design{position:fixed;left:50%; margin-left: 456px; text-align: left;top:5%;}
.default-floatbox-design .cd-title{display:none;min-height:22px;_height:22px;background-color:#3B9AD7;background-image:none;color:#ffffff;font-size:11px;text-transform:uppercase;}
.default-floatbox-design .cd-icon{background-image:none;height:0px;width:0px;}
.default-floatbox-design .cd-content{background-color:#ffffff;background-image:none;color:#364A90;}
.default-floatbox-design .cd-footer{display:none;min-height:0px;_height:0px;background-color:#3B9AD7;background-image:none;color:#ffffff;}
.default-floatbox-design .cd-icon-footer{background-image:none;height:0px;width:0px;}
.default-sidebox-design{}
.default-sidebox-design .cd-title{display:block;min-height:53px;_height:53px;background-color:#bbe5ee;background-image:none;color:#1c869d;font-size:16px;text-transform:uppercase;}
.default-sidebox-design .cd-icon{background-image:none;height:0px;width:0px;}
.default-sidebox-design .cd-content{background-color:#cef1f8;background-image:none;color:#1c869d;}
.default-sidebox-design .cd-footer{display:none;min-height:0px;_height:0px;background-color:#3B9AD7;background-image:none;color:#ffffff;}
.default-sidebox-design .cd-icon-footer{background-image:none;height:0px;width:0px;}
.default-design{}
.default-design .cd-title{display:block;min-height:22px;_height:22px;background-image:none;color:#1c869d;font-size:34px;text-transform:none;}
.default-design .cd-icon{background-image:none;height:0px;width:0px;}
.default-design .cd-content{background-color:#ccf0f7;background-image:none;color:#1c869d;}
.default-design .cd-footer{display:none;min-height:0px;_height:0px;background-color:#3B9AD7;background-image:none;color:#ffffff;}
.default-design .cd-icon-footer{background-image:none;height:0px;width:0px;}
.searchmasks-view-1{}
.searchmasks-view-1 .cd-title{display:block;min-height:53px;_height:53px;background-color:#d0f2fa;background-image:none;color:#000;font-size:23px;text-transform:none;}
.searchmasks-view-1 .cd-icon{background-image:none;height:0px;width:0px;}
.searchmasks-view-1 .cd-content{background-color:#d7f8ff;background-image:none;background-repeat:no-repeat;color:#1c869d;}
.searchmasks-view-1 .cd-footer{display:none;min-height:0px;_height:0px;background-color:#3B9AD7;background-image:none;color:#ffffff;}
.searchmasks-view-1 .cd-icon-footer{background-image:none;height:0px;width:0px;}
.contentsideboxes-view-3{}
.contentsideboxes-view-3 .cd-title{display:none;min-height:22px;_height:22px;background-image:none;color:#1c869d;font-size:34px;text-transform:none;}
.contentsideboxes-view-3 .cd-icon{background-image:none;height:0px;width:0px;}
.contentsideboxes-view-3 .cd-content{background-color:#ccf0f7;background-image:none;color:#1c869d;}
.contentsideboxes-view-3 .cd-footer{display:none;min-height:0px;_height:0px;background-color:#3B9AD7;background-image:none;}
.contentsideboxes-view-3 .cd-icon-footer{background-image:none;height:0px;width:0px;}
.contentsideboxes-view-2{}
.contentsideboxes-view-2 .cd-title{display:none;min-height:22px;_height:22px;background-image:none;color:#1c869d;font-size:34px;text-transform:none;}
.contentsideboxes-view-2 .cd-icon{background-image:none;height:0px;width:0px;}
.contentsideboxes-view-2 .cd-content{background-color:#ccf0f7;background-image:none;color:#1c869d;}
.contentsideboxes-view-2 .cd-footer{display:none;min-height:0px;_height:0px;background-color:#3B9AD7;background-image:none;}
.contentsideboxes-view-2 .cd-icon-footer{background-image:none;height:0px;width:0px;}
/* content design - off */